MicroVision Announces Second Quarter 2020 Results

MVIS

REDMOND, Wash., Aug. 05, 2020 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- MicroVision, Inc. (NASDAQ:MVIS), a leader in innovative ultra-miniature projection display and sensing technology, today announced its second quarter 2020 results.

Revenue for the second quarter of 2020 was $0.6 million, compared to $1.2 million for the second quarter of 2019. MicroVision's net loss for the second quarter of 2020 was $2.3 million, or $0.02 per share, compared to a net loss of $9.0 million, or $0.08 per share for the second quarter of 2019. The Company ended the second quarter of 2020 with $7.8 million in cash and cash equivalents, compared to $5.8 million at the end of the fourth quarter of 2019.

“With the assistance of our financial advisor, Craig-Hallum Capital Group LLC, we continue to explore strategic alternatives to maximize the value of MicroVision for our shareholders, including the sale of a product vertical, strategic investment, or potential sale or merger of the Company,” said Sumit Sharma, MicroVision's Chief Executive Officer.

About MicroVision

MicroVision is the creator of PicoP® scanning technology, an ultra-miniature sensing and projection solution based on the laser beam scanning methodology pioneered by the Company. MicroVision’s platform approach for this sensing and display solution means that its technology can be adapted to a wide array of applications and form factors. We combine our hardware, software, and algorithms to unlock value for our customers by providing them a differentiated advanced solution for a rapidly evolving, always-on world.

MicroVision has a substantial portfolio of patents relating to laser beam scanning projection and sensing. MicroVision’s industry leading technology is a result of its extensive research and development. The Company is based in Redmond, Washington.
